- The Carolina Panthers own the first overall pick in the draft.
- Ohio State's C.J. Stroud is listed as the favorite to come off the board first at -350.
- Alabama's Will Anderson is the first non-QB listed at +15000.
The NFL Draft will be held in Kansas City, Missouri between April 27th-29th. The first round will be telecast on ESPN/ABC on Thursday night starting at 8p and running past midnight. The top of the draft is likely to see a handful of quarterbacks come off the board early, but which quarterback will hear his name first? Sportsbooks believe that the Carolina Panthers first selection will be a quarterback, which is why they list four quarterbacks with the best odds to hear their name first.

The Carolina Panthers traded with the Chicago Bears on March 10th for the rights to the first overall selection in the NFL Draft. The Panthers sent their first round selection (9th), a late-second-round pick (No. 61), a 2024 first-round selection and a 2025 second-round pick to Chicago in exchange for the first overall pick. They did this, presumably, with the intent of selecting a new franchise quarterback. Sportsbook odds reflect that strategy with all non-QB options listed at a probability of 0.66% or lower.
C.J. Stroud is the runaway favorite to hear his name first at the Draft. Stroud would be the third Buckeye quarterback selected in the first round since 2019. If Bryce Young were to hear his name first, he would be the third Alabama quarterback selected in the first two rounds since 2020. And while Anthony Richardson has been a fast-riser in the pre-Draft process, he's still considered a long-shot to go number one at a generous +1000.
